Our 2025 Season ends Sunday, October 5th. The Classic American Burger Joint – family owned and operated since 1960. Classic Cheeseburgers, Homemade Onion Rings, Hand Dipped Fish, Fresh Blended Shakes and so much more. As seen on Diners, Drive-Ins & Dives… TWICE! Excited to be serving for our 63rd Season
Family-run counter serve since 1960 offering burgers, fried fish, malts & other American classics.
